In keeping with the Haunted Mansion our party is currently exploring, I came up with a WHOLE haunted library ala Gomez Addams

Encounter Mechanics
- The books remain inert until one is pulled from the shelf. When disturbed, all eight awaken.
- They can hover off the ground, flapping like birds. Some have the ability to run.
- Their CR can be set between 2–3 each (slightly weaker alone, but dangerous as a group).
- The fight can escalate as more books fall open—giving your party a frantic “stop pulling tomes!” realization.

Encounter Notes
- Trigger: The fight begins when one book is pulled from the shelf. The rest join after 1 round, 1d4 books at a time, for rising tension.
- Tactics: Books hover and swarm. “Art of War” boosts the others, “Odyssey” disrupts positioning, “Dracula” heals mid-fight.
- Party Balance: Facing all 8 at once could overwhelm — consider staggering their arrival for a cinematic escalation.
Frankenstein
(Book Monster)
Medium Construct, chaotic neutral
Armor Class Class 12 (reinforced binding)
Hit Points 72 (9d10+27)
Speed 20 ft., hover 30 ft.
STR 14 (+2) DEX 10 (+0) CON 16 (+3)
INT 8 (-1) WIS 12 (+1) CHA 9 (-1)
Damage Resistances lightning, necrotic, bludgeoning, piercing, slashing from nonmagical attacks
Damage Vulnerabilities fire (stitched, brittle binding burns easily)
Condition Immunities charmed, frightened, poisoned, prone, exhaustion
Senses darkvision 60 ft., passive Perception 11
Languages understands Common, cannot speak
Challenge 4 (1,100 XP)
Traits
- Stitched Binding. Whenever the Frankenstein Tome would be reduced to 0 hit points, roll a d6. It instead drops to (d6) hit points as arcs of lightning bind its pages back together. On a 1 the tome explodes in a ball of lighting. Each creature within 10 ft. must make a DC 13 Constitution saving throw, taking 9 (2d8) lightning damage on a failed save, or half on a success.
- Crackling Aura. Any creature that starts its turn within 15 ft. takes 3 (1d6), 10 ft. takes 6 (2d6), or 5 ft. 9 (3d6), lightning damage.
- Unnatural Construction. Advantage on saving throws against being paralyzed, poisoned, or stunned.
Actions
- Lightning Shock. Ranged Spell Attack: +5 to hit, range 60 ft., one target. Hit: 13 (3d8) lightning damage.
- Animate Object (1/day). Animates one nearby chair, table, or small bookshelf. Treated as an Animated Armor under Frankenstein’s control.
